Northeast Florida Healthy Start Coalition is Hiring a Community Liaison Near Jacksonville, FL

Job Title: Community Liaison
Division/Department: Coordinated Intake & Referral
Essential Duties & Responsibilities: The Community Liaison is responsible for provider and community outreach for the Coalition. Outreach includes primarily working with public and private maternity care providers and hospitals to promote the Universal Screen and CONNECT program in Northeast Florida.
Specific Activities:
Provider Outreach
•Responsible for agency"'s provider outreach for CONNECT program. Oversees successful implementation of the Universal prenatal/postnatal screen, including all provider visits; collection, review and submission of screens for targeted providers; and annual provider trainings.
•Conduct at least 25 weekly contacts with providers.
•Conduct monthly mail outs to at least 30 Providers
•Maintain comprehensive log of all provider communication, training and visits.
•Updates and assist with providing data to public and private maternity care providers and delivery hospitals on screening rates on at least a quarterly basis.
•Create and distribute provider and patient incentives tied to Connect as appropriate and as needed.
•Initiate Contact with Pediatricians
Strategy Development & Implementation
•Develop provider engagement plan, including activities like monthly updates, provider summits, grand rounds and provider weeks.
•Implement activities to increase prenatal and infant screening and consent to screen rates
•Provides staff support to the Screening Improvement Task Force (meetings, agendas, minutes,).
Administrative
•Assist with communication activities related to CONNECT (participant profiles, spokespeople, pictures, content for Healthy Start providers' page).
•Assist with CONNECT correspondence to providers and families
Other:
•All other duties as assigned by the CI&R Director
Education and/or Work Experience Requirements:
•BS or BA in a health, social service or communications field; at least one year experience preferred.
•May substitute one or more years' experience in a health social service, education or related field.
Additional Eligibility Qualifications:
•Excellent verbal and written communication skills, including ability to effectively communicate with internal and external clients.
•Experience or strong interest in Maternal and Child Health or non-profit work.
•Must be able to exhibit the following qualities; open minded, excellent organization skills, self-motivated, flexible, friendly and professional demeanor and exceptional attention to detail.
•Excellent computer proficiency (MS Office "" Word, Excel and Outlook)
•Must be able to work under pressure and meet deadlines, while maintaining a positive attitude and providing exemplary customer service.
•Knowledge of health and human service providers.
•Ability to work flexible traditional and nontraditional hours.
•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with Coalition partner agency staff and the general public.
•Experience in oral and written presentations.
•Knowledge of community resources.
•Professional appearance and demeanor utilizing CONNECT attire
•Ability to work independently and to carry out assignments to completion within parameters of instructions given prescribed routines, and standard accepted practices.
•Must be able to communicate effectively and be a team player at the Coalition.
•Must be able to commit to the Coalition vision and be passionate about its mission.
•Requires reliable transportation, as travel is required, valid driver"'s license, good driving record and automobile insurance.

About Northeast Florida Healthy Start Coalition

In Northeast Florida, too many babies die from preventable causes and lack of health services. The Healthy Start Coalition leads the community effort to reduce infant death and improve the health of children, childbearing women, fathers and their families in Northeast Florida.
